Bosnia and Herzegovina will host the final tournament of the Women's Under-19 European Championship. How significant is this for this generation and for women's football in our country?
I believe this is one of the most significant moments for women's football in Bosnia and Herzegovina. For the second time, we have the opportunity to host this major competition, and we're aware that it brings the attention women's football deserves. I'm especially happy that our girls will experience everything that comes with a European Championship, and I'm certain they'll give their best so that women's football remains visible and continues to grow even after this tournament.
During the preparation period, you also played friendly matches against Slovenia. How much did those games help you gain a clearer picture of the team ahead of the Euro?
The friendly games against Slovenia were of great importance to us. Since Slovenia plays in a system used by many major national teams, we had the opportunity to work on adapting to and facing different formations, which represents a certain challenge for us. The victory we achieved gave us the additional confidence we needed.
The group Bosnia and Herzegovina is in is very demanding. How do you view the upcoming duels against Germany, Sweden, and Poland?
The group is certainly demanding, but that's precisely what gives us the opportunity to see where we currently stand and motivates us even more to give our maximum. It's a special feeling to play against national teams that have won the European Championship multiple times. Our position is clear – we didn't come just to participate, we came to compete.
